Robert Morris, a prominent Texas megachurch founder, was released from jail after serving six months for lewd acts with a minor in 1982. Despite stepping down from his church in 2024 amid allegations, he pleaded guilty last year and was sentenced to ten years probation. The victim, Cindy Clemishire, welcomed the sentencing, while Morris expressed remorse through his lawyer, acknowledging his wrongdoings and seeking forgiveness. He now registers as a sex offender under Texas supervision and owes restitution to Clemishire and jail costs.
